When's the best time to buy a used Evoque?

I am looking to buy a one year old Range Rover Evoque. However, I've been told that a new model is due in the next few months. I was wondering what impact that would have on the value of used models? It worth me waiting until after the launch in the hope that loads of Evoke owners will trade in their cars for the new model, pushing the price down?

Asked on 17 June 2015 by Daydreamer

Answered by Honest John
From August the Evoque gets JLR's new 2.0 litre chain cam Ingenium diesel engine instead of the old 2.2 litre belt cam Peugeot/Ford diesel engine. That's the big difference. Yes, there should be a spike of Evoque owners upgrading to the new engine for the September reg and that might drive used prices down a bit by October.
